Lindner owned a minority stake both before and after that period but was the Reds' CEO for six seasons, and each of those years the team lost more games than it won.He approved the trade for Ken Griffey Jr. in 2000, even sending his private jet to bring Griffey to Cincinnati and then personally driving the hometown star back to Cinergy Field from Lunken Airport in his Rolls-Royce.But as the Reds' losses mounted, Lindner never spoke publicly to fans and privately bristled at talk-radio criticism.That period ended in late 2005 when Lindner sold a controlling stake in the Reds to a group headed by Bob Castellini.Shy and scornful of reporters, Lindner nevertheless became a focus of media attention because of his substantial wealth and his far-flung business dealings.The controversies included millions of dollars in political contributions as his Chiquita Brands International Inc. was waging a trade war with European countries, a bevy of lawsuits and federal charges over business deals that benefited Lindner and his company more than other shareholders, and a high-profile battle with the Enquirer in 1998 over a series of critical stories on Chiquita.Lindner built a national reputation in the 1980s as a high-risk trader, becoming a business partner of symbols of the decade's excess such as junk-bond king Michael Milken and Cincinnati's own Charles Keating.He was the classic "value investor," buying properties few other investors wanted and waiting years, or even decades, to reap the benefits.That gave him a portfolio including the old Penn Central railroad, Circle K convenience stores and New York City landmark Grand Central Station.But Lindner spent the two decades before his death shedding assets that didn't deal with insurance and transferring others to his three sons. he always rode in front of the car, no doubt listening to npr..and wnku.. From humble beginnings running his father's dairy store in Norwood, Carl Henry Lindner Jr. grew into a billionaire, a friend of U.S. presidents and Greater Cincinnati's most successful entrepreneur.For nearly a century until he died late Monday at age 92 , the former Reds owner never shed the fierce competitiveness and loyalty that made him a hometown icon.His influence ran to every corner of Greater Cincinnati. [2] By the mid-1960s, Carl Sr.'s sons were running the family's businesses: Carl Jr. was running American Financial Group, Robert was running United Dairy Farmers, and Richard was running the Thriftway Food Drug grocery chain, which later joined with Winn-Dixie.[3].
